About The Role

The Aviation Planner is responsible for the strategic and operational planning of airfield infrastructure and activities to ensure safe, efficient, and compliant airport operations. This role involves close coordination with various airport stakeholders including air traffic control, airlines, ground handling, maintenance, and project teams to ensure effective allocation and use of airfield resources. The planner supports short, medium, and long-term planning aligned with regulatory, environmental, and capacity requirements.

Key Responsibilities
  • Lead / Coordinate the development of airport master plans and phasing plans to ensure the short-term and long-term aviation requirements
  • Traffic forecast analysis / review and Capacity analysis
  • Lead / Coordinate with other airport experts (environment, building, security, etc.) to provide planning support to design studies
  • Develop and maintain airfield operational plans covering runways, taxiways, aprons, stands, and support areas
  • Analyze and forecast aircraft movements to determine capacity requirements and optimize stand allocation, GSE operations, etc.
  • Airfield and Apron Planning and Stand Optimization
  • Conduct feasibility studies and risk assessments for Airfield projects; Terminal and Landside would be an added advantage
  • Liaise with engineering & project teams to provide operational input during design and construction phases & to ensure that all applicable policies, procedures, and regulations are followed, that current techniques are utilized, and that quality is acceptable
  • Support sustainability initiatives in airfield operations, including emissions and fuel efficiency planning
  • Performance sizing (runway length, RET, etc.)
  • Aeronautical studies / obstacles assessment
  • Approach / Departure procedures analysis (PANS OPS/TERPS)
  • Aircraft related performance studies
  • Perform dynamic Airside simulations with simulation softwares such as CAST Airside, AirTOP, etc.
  • Develop the airside simulation activity with other Experts
